Lord of Gabriel Knight Posted November 11, 2017 Share Posted November 11, 2017 (edited) It looks nice, but I think there is too much contrast in your colors. The green's lightest tint is really bright compared to it's mid and dark hues. This is exacerbated by using large amounts of shades right next to tints, namely on her neck cavity. Also, your sprite looks flat because it isn't shaded as if it were a three dimensional object. You should look at examples of spheres and use that to give depth to your form. For example, the left side of her bangs should be a bit darker, since her head is round. Lastly, it's generally not good to have the outline color used inside the sprite. I'd change the edge of the cloth to either the darkest skin hue or the darkest clothing hue. Your art style is very cute and your sprite is very clean, so just work on giving it a more realistic look and it should be golden! vilkalizer Posted November 11, 2017 Share Posted November 11, 2017 4 hours ago, Lord of Gabriel Knight said: Lastly, it's generally not good to have the outline color used inside the sprite. It depends a lot on which FE style you're going for. FE8 tends to use the outline colour more than 6/7, sometimes a lot more. As for my own comments, I'm bad with mugs so take it with a grain of salt, but I feel it looks desaturated, especially the skin - you typically get full 255 for the R and G values, with some variance in B. Also, I think the neck is a bit blobby. At that angle, this thing feels like it should be breaking it up and adding some shadow. Again though, mugs not really my speciality.
